Moving to Charlotte, NC

Known as the “Queen City,” Charlotte combines Southern hospitality with a modern urban vibe. It is home to major employers, including Bank of America, as well as attractions such as the NASCAR Hall of Fame.

Residents enjoy parks such as Freedom Park, restaurants and nightlife in the NoDa and South End neighborhoods, and sporting events featuring the Carolina Panthers and Charlotte Hornets. Nature lovers appreciate Lake Norman and the U.S. National Whitewater Center, both just a short drive away.

Compared to Washington, DC, Charlotte offers a lower cost of living, more spacious housing, and shorter commutes, while maintaining high-quality schools, diverse neighborhoods, and a growing job market. The suburbs of Ballantyne, Matthews, and Huntersville are especially popular with families and remote professionals.

How much does it cost to move from Washington, DC to Charlotte, NC?

How much does it cost to move from Washington, DC to Charlotte, NC?

Our pricing is based on a flat rate, which depends on the size of your move and the distance. The minimum rate starts at $1,100, with an average cost of $1,900 to move a one-bedroom apartment from Washington, DC to Charlotte, NC. Our flat rate includes professional movers, a fully equipped truck, fuel, tolls, mileage, basic insurance, and no hidden fees. We also offer additional services such as packing and storage to accommodate your specific needs.

Estimated Moving Costs

Move Size Price Range Average Price
Studio / 1 bedroom $1,100 - $2,900 $1,900
2 - 3 bedrooms $1,700 - $4,200 $2,900
4+ bedrooms $2,200 - $5,500 $3,700
Small Commercial Office $1,900 - $4,500 $3,000
Medium Commercial Office $3,000 - $7,000 $4,900
Large Commercial Office $5,000 - $11,000 $7,600

It is usually cheapest to move in winter, in January and February. Demand is lower in winter, so moving companies can offer slightly cheaper rates. 

The busiest month is July. In general, the period from May to September is considered the peak season, when there are the most moves and the highest prices.
